Possibly, They are all painted up but I forgot the pics of those
Its the progress on the carriage thats more exciting...
Did alot of work today.
Its got a coat of varnish so is lovely and shiny and finally received its hinged chimney (for going under bridges)
Theres are steps fitted and I made a hinged pub sign bracket.



(The pipe is for the beer, no brakes on this one)

The sign braket and the sign which I shall sublimation print onto aluminium
